Position Title: HVAC Sheet Metal Foreman
Department: Construction
Reports To: Sheet Metal Superintendent
Position Summary
The HVAC Sheet Metal Foreman is responsible for supervising and coordinating the installation of ductwork and sheet metal systems for heating, ventilation, and air conditioning (HVAC) projects. This role ensures that field crews work safely, efficiently, and according to plans, specifications, and code requirements. The Sheet Metal Foreman serves as the key liaison between project management, other trades, and the installation team, ensuring quality and timely completion of all assigned work.
Key Responsibilities
-Supervise, direct, and schedule daily work activities of sheet metal installers and apprentices.
-Review blueprints, drawings, and specifications to plan duct layout and installation.
-Ensure accurate installation of ductwork, fittings, and accessories for supply, return, and exhaust systems.
-Maintain compliance with OSHA safety standards and company policies; lead daily safety meetings and enforce safe work practices.
-Coordinate manpower, materials, tools, and equipment to maintain productivity and schedule.
-Inspect duct installation for accuracy, quality, and adherence to mechanical codes and project requirements.
-Work with project managers, superintendents, and general contractors to resolve field issues and sequencing conflicts.
-Train, mentor, and evaluate apprentices and less experienced crew members.
-Complete daily reports, timecards, and jobsite documentation as required.
Ensure proper use and maintenance of equipment, tools, and jobsite resources.
Qualifications
-Minimum 5+ years of sheet metal/HVAC duct installation experience, with at least 2+ years in a supervisory or lead role.
-Strong knowledge of HVAC duct fabrication, installation, and mechanical systems.
-Ability to read and interpret construction drawings and specifications.
-Working knowledge of SMACNA standards and mechanical codes.
-Proven leadership, organizational, and communication skills.
-OSHA 30 certification (preferred) or willingness to obtain.
-Valid driver’s license and reliable transportation.
-Physically able to lift 50+ lbs and work in various site conditions.
